How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Trieste at Boca Raton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Trieste at Boca Raton Studio Apartments | $1,819 | $1,819 | $1,819 |
| Trieste at Boca Raton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,865 | $1,750 | $1,999 |
| Trieste at Boca Raton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,550 | $2,009 | $3,000 |
| Trieste at Boca Raton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,550 | $2,550 | $2,550 |
